Follow on Google News | Give Summer Jobs to Students, Out-of-School Youths - Edgardo "Sonny" AngaraTeam Pnoy senatorial candidate Edgardo "Sonny" Angara today urged government agencies and private companies to create employment for students and out-of-school youths this summer.
He said youth workers in government could provide general assistance in basic administrative tasks as public service assistants, computer operators, communication equipment operator assistants, accounting clerks and records clerk. "Today's job market is challenging," According to Angara, some private companies also provide summer jobs in the hope of training promising young students. The lawmaker from Aurora stressed the need to give students the necessary exposure in career-related fields to enhance their formal education training and gain hands on experience in their field of study. Summer jobs programs and services should also be open to out-of-school youths aged 18 to 24 years who are planning to return to school this June, he said. Angara encouraged other industries to reach out more to local youth. He said the number of young people employed at the height of summer is expected to increase due to plans by most private tertiary schools to increase tuition and other fees this June. ABOUT REP.
